Latest Patents
Colin Wayne McFaull holds a patent for a "Conveyor system and method for transporting material." This invention features load-carrying belts and a conveyor system that incorporates these belts. The system is designed to transport material from a loading zone to an unloading zone. In one embodiment, a specially configured belt is suspended from a haul rope that loops around a pair of rotatable end sheaves. The design may include intermediary support towers with support rollers, enhancing the system's stability. The belt is uniquely configured to create compartments for transporting material, which can be opened and closed as needed during the loading and unloading processes. This innovative approach may also include corrugations to improve the belt's flexibility.
